GWS youngster Ahern traded to Kangaroos

Injury-prone Greater Western Sydney midfielder Paul Ahern has joined North Melbourne after two seasons with the Giants.

Young midfielder Paul Ahern will join North Melbourne after two injury-ravaged AFL seasons at Greater Western Sydney.

The Giants will receive pick No.69 in exchange for the 20-year-old, who was taken with pick No.7 in the 2014 draft.

The Victorian, who is yet to make his AFL debut, missed the 2016 season after undergoing a knee reconstruction - his second in as many years - in February.

He is unlikely to appear for the Kangaroos in 2017 after tearing his right anterior cruciate ligament last month.

Ahern joins forward Cam McCarthy (Fremantle), midfielder Jack Steele (St Kilda) and veteran defender Joel Patfull (retirement) as players to depart the Giants during this year's trade period.
